Former Ireland Schools fly-half Andrew Dunne has signed a two-year deal with Bath.
Dunne will provide cover for Olly Barkley and Chris Malone, even though he is determined to become first choice.
“My ambition is to break through into the first team. I realise that Chris Malone has been playing well for the last two seasons at fly-half so competition for a starting place will be fierce," he said.
“However, the club brought me in to provide competition at fly-half and I feel that it can only be a positive factor for both me and for the club.
"With that in mind, I am looking to make a positive impact at Bath Rugby and am excited about a new challenge within a club that has assembled a strong and ambitious playing squad headed by excellent coaches,” said Dunne.
